November 11, 1947

Hon. Richard Fielding Harless
Member of Congress
House Office Building
Washington, D.C.
Dear Mr. Harless:

  The National Congress of American Indians will hold its Fourth Annual Convention at Santa Fe, New Mexico, from December 4th to the 6th, inclusive.

  We are holding this Convention in the heart of the Indian country in order to get first hand information concerning the Indians and their problems. Your interest in Indian affairs, as well as your intimate knowledge of their problems would make your presence at the Convention most desirable and I have the honor to extend to you an invitation to appear on our program on one of the days suitable to your convenience.

  Hoping that you can accept this invitation, I am
  Sincerely,
  President, NCAI
